I was contacted via email to set up a phone interview within 24 hour of applying. The phone interview was a quick personal discussion of my University education and the projects that I had mentioned on my resume, he asked about how long the code was trying to get a handle on if I had worked with large code bases. Then the interviewer began asking C++ questions, const keyword in a function, what is a pure virtual function, what is the difference between a balanced tree and a binary tree, what is the advantage of the balanced tree over the binary tree? There were a couple other questions I cannot remember. He was very nice and when I was struggling to come up with the exact keyword he would often give hints.
I then went in for an in person interview and met with the whole Fibersim team and they each asked different questions, mostly about C++, but there were a few questions about SQL and XML. The team was very friendly and there was even a whovian with a sonic screwdriver pen. The interview lasted 3.5 hours but felt like a lot less since it was only 30 min with each team member. The interview was a great experience and I quite enjoyed my time there.
